
IDEALARC DC-600
F-50
TROUBLESHOOTING & REPAIR
NOTE: If it is necessary to remove and
replace only one or two individual
SCRs and they are easy to work on,
use these procedures.
1.
Disconnect main AC input power
supply to the machine.
2.
Identify and label the following :
a.
The transformer secondary
lead (heavy aluminum conduc-
tor) connected to the anode of
the SCR heat sink for each
assembly to be removed. See
Figure F.19.
b.
The snubber leads for each
SCR heat sink to be removed.
See Figure F.19.
SCR / SCR OUTPUT BRIDGE REMOVAL
FIGURE F.19 - Individual Heat Sink Removal
A. REMOVAL OF INDIVIDUAL SCR HEAT SINK
3.
Disconnect the transformer sec-
ondary lead to the anode of the
heat sink assembly using 1/2"
socket wrench and 1/2" open end
wrench.
4.
Disconnect the gate lead to the
SCR.
a.
If the gate lead is cut, it will
have to be re-soldered when
the replacement SCR is
installed.
b.
If a new snubber board is used,
install properly.
